         <description><![CDATA[<div>1. APOR(A Packet Of Rice) is a project participated by volunteers<br>2. APOR is a self funded project initiated by a group of volunteers who distribute meals and food items right to the doorsteps of the needy senior citizens who are living in rental flats in Singapore. Food staples such as bananas, buns, bread, biscuits and packet drinks are purchased from local supermarkets or wholesaler. &nbsp; These items are then transported to the stipulated meet up point for volunteers to bundle them into convenient take and go packages according to the recipients’ HDB block numbers. APOR will extend their care and concerns to needy senior citizens in other parts of Singapore as well. They welcome any contributions or sponsorships. Nothing is ever considered too small for their old folks.<br><br></div><div><br><br></div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>One example of how individuals contribute to meet the needs of society is Ken Yeo and his family, and the project of "Unmanned Free Food Pantry". The family created the UFFP to ensure that the less fortunate get their hands on some food that they may not be able to afford. These pantries are placed around void decks of HDB blocks, unmanned by anyone to supply food such as Indo-mie and Gardenia bread. The reason why the pantries are unmanned is because the Yeo Family believes in respect for the less fortunate, since some of them may feel shy or have no dignity for receiving free food from someone else. By having no one manning the pantries, the less fortunate can receive food without feeling like they owe the family. The trust that will be established between the family and these less fortunate people will result in the increase in likelihood of these fortunate people visiting these pantries because they are grateful and will let other people know about this. The more people will know about the kind deeds done by the Yeo Family and the pantries will gain popularity. Some non profit organisations may take notice of the idea and collaborate with the family to expand the project, throughout the whole of Singapore. Hence, a larger proportion of the less fortunate in Singapore will receive the aid of free food , further enhancing the contributions done by the Yeo Family in doing good for the society.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Formal groups such as Food form the Heart or Food bank collect food from local Singaporeans and appealing to students through assembly tlaks in different ways. But the object is the same and that is to donate food the needy groups for them to benefit. For example food form the heart collaborates with Pei Hwa Secondary conducting a food drive. A certain week students are parents are being asked by the Sec 4s to donate food items. The Sec 4s pack the food by categories and help load into the food form teh heart trucks. These foods will go into their food from the heart inventory. Food from the heart has a community shop that sells food just like at Fairprice but at a heavily discounted price for the needy to afford basic food items such as packets of noodles, soups, bread, etc... The food that is in there inventory is used to restock these community shop to ensure a continual supply of food to the needy, the needy can then pick and buy food according to their needs at home at a heavily discounted price, this would not burn a whole in their wallet and save them in the long run as they have what they need, thus they have food to eat at home for the kids and family and thus meeting the needs of society </div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>The government contributes by provision of funds for society's needs; the Singapore government has provided a hundred dollars worth of Community Development Council (CDC) vouchers for their low-income families in mid-2022; this was done so through the Household Support Package as part of the country's Budget 2022.<br>By providing these vouchers for households, low-income families will receive a separate source of money from the government that can allow them to pay for meals. Through this, families will be able to cut down on expenditure for meals from their own income, relieving the burden of workload and budgeting on low-income families while at the same time, making sure they receive proper meals for a period of time; this is how the government provides basic necessities for low-income families in Singapore.</div>]]></description>
